Summary/Abstract: This paper discusses the recent case law of the Court of Justice of the European Union (the ECJ), in particular the Wintersteiger Case, concerning jurisdiction pursuant to Article 5(3) of the EC Brussels I Regulation in disputes arising out of alleged intellectual property rights infringements committed by means of content placed on the Internet.
